Technological Infrastructure and Program Components

Modern VR gaming training programs in the Netherlands utilize sophisticated hardware and software ecosystems. Facilities employ high-refresh-rate headsets, precision controllers, and full-body tracking systems that capture nuanced player movements. The vr gaming training programs netherlands field memo documents how these technological investments create immersive training environments where players experience minimal latency and maximum environmental fidelity.

Key components of these programs include:

  • Scenario-based training modules that simulate competitive match conditions and pressure situations
  • Real-time performance analytics dashboards providing immediate feedback to players and coaches
  • Customizable difficulty progression systems that adapt to individual player skill levels
  • Multiplayer VR environments enabling team-based training and communication drills
  • Recovery and mental conditioning modules utilizing VR for visualization and stress management
  • Replay analysis tools that allow players to review their performance from multiple perspectives

Integration with Traditional Coaching Methods

The most effective vr gaming training programs netherlands field memo implementations combine virtual reality training with traditional coaching approaches. Hybrid models leverage VR’s strengths in controlled skill development while maintaining the interpersonal coaching relationships and strategic guidance that experienced coaches provide. This integration creates comprehensive player development ecosystems where technology enhances rather than replaces human expertise.

Coaches utilize VR performance data to inform their strategic guidance and identify areas requiring additional attention. Players benefit from both the objective metrics generated by VR systems and the subjective insights provided by experienced coaching staff. This combination addresses technical skill development, tactical understanding, and psychological preparation simultaneously.
